A graduate of Tulane University
Medical School, Dr. Cooke is certified by the American Board of Internal
Medicine and also has Physician Certification in Acupuncture in New York
State. Dr. Cooke was recently honored with election to Fellowship in the
American College of Physicians-American Society of Internal Medicine. For over twelve years she worked in the demanding field of emergency medicine. Five of those years were spent in one of New York City’s busiest ERs. She has cared for over 20,000 patients in the acute care setting. She currently holds an appointment as Assistant in Medicine at New York-Presbyterian Hospital’s Columbia division. She has served as Clinical Preceptor both in Physical Diagnosis at Columbia University College of Physicians and Surgeons, and in Acupuncture to the UCLA School of Medicine’s Medical Acupuncture for Physicians course. Dr. Cooke is also an Aviation Medical Examiner certified by the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A), and holds a Master’s in Public Health from Tulane University with seven years of occupational health experience. Dr. Cooke maintains close contacts with many practitioners, both conventional and alternative, and will make appropriate referral for a range of treatments including orthopedics, gynecology, psychotherapy, massage, or Alexander technique. Dr. Cooke speaks French, Italian, Portuguese and Spanish. |
